The particlesin a solid are packed closely together and they can only vibrate about their fixed positions because there are little space between them, but there is space, therefore, solids can be compressed, but it takes extreme pressure, and it can not be compressed much.

Why unlike gases liquids and solids can not be compressed easily?

Liquids and solids have particles that are already in close proximity and held together by strong intermolecular forces, making compressing them difficult. In contrast, gases have particles that are far apart and move freely, allowing them to be compressed more easily.

Can solid be compressed Give reason?

Solids cannot be compressed easily because their particles are arranged closely together in a fixed position. When external pressure is applied, the particles cannot move closer together, causing the solid to resist compression. However, under extreme pressure, solids can be compressed slightly due to the deformation of their atomic structure.
